KYLIE MINOGUE AUCTIONS HER LEXUS CT 200H RAISING FUNDS FOR THE NSPCC



Superstar and NSPCC ambassador Kylie Minogue has teamed up with the NSPCC and Lexus to auction her very own car, raising much-needed funds to go towards ending cruelty to children. Kylie, who is the face of the new Lexus CT200h, the world’s first luxury compact car, has been driving her own stylish CT200h throughout 2011. It is Kylie’s car which will take centre stage on the night to help raise much needed funds for the charity. The auction will be held at the annual NSPCC City of London Christmas dinner, taking place at the Savoy Hotel, London on December 1st, where guests will have the chance to bid exclusively on Kylie’s personalised Lexus.


9th China (Guangzhou) International Auto Show: World premiere of the new GS 250



Increasingly important in the automotive calendar, the 9th China International Auto show is held at the futuristic China Import and Export Fair Complex in Guangzhou. It is here that the new Lexus GS 250 makes its world premiere.

With a bold new design, powerful performance, dynamic handling and a host of advanced technologies, the new GS 250 represents a powerful change. An advanced 2.5-litre aluminium-alloy V6 petrol engine powers the new GS 250, which can accelerate from 0 to 62 mph in 8.6 seconds. A 6-speed automatic gearbox seamlessly transmits in excess of 200 DIN hp and more than 250 Nm of torque to the rear wheels for effortless performance, while paddle shift controls let the driver make rapid gear changes.

Following the reveal of the new GS 350 at Pebble Beach, the premiere of the GS 450h in Frankfurt and the debut of new GS F SPORT models in Las Vegas, the choice of Guangzhou in China for the launch of the new GS 250 underscores the truly global nature of the Lexus brand.

The new GS 250 will go on sale in Europe in 2012.


New GS F SPORT premiered at the SEMA show in Las Vegas


Lexus has chosen the SEMA show, held in the Las Vegas convention centre, to reveal the new GS F SPORT. SEMA is the premier trade event for specialist automotive products, attracting more than 100,000 industry experts from over 100 countries.

With distinctive and assertive styling the new GS F SPORT creates a highly dynamic impression. Honeycomb mesh spindle grille, rear spoiler and exclusive 19″ alloy wheels are unique to the F SPORT. And the bespoke interior features a new leather design, drilled sport pedals and F SPORT, dimpled leather, steering wheel. The GS 450h F SPORT is additionally specified with Dynamic Rear Steering, for highly responsive handling.

Powered by Lexus Hybrid Drive or a petrol engine, the new GS F SPORT models will go on sale in Europe in 2012.

Lexus Kicks Off Sponsorship of the National Schools Rugby Tournament

Lexus has a proud record of supporting rugby and this year it goes to the grass roots of the sport with its inaugural sponsorship of the National Schools Rugby Tournament.

The annual competition, established in 1996, promotes skills and sportsmanship among young players through a friendly but hard-fought competition. The 2011/2012 tournament will bring together around 3,000 players aged between eight and 13 in 120 teams from 80 schools.

The Lexus National Schools Rugby Tournament will feature four regional festivals, in Warwick, Reigate, Richmond and Epsom, from which the top teams will progress to the competition finals at Epsom College on 4 March next year. The action begins on November 13 at Warwick School for teams from the North and Midlands.

Lexus will be a highly visible and active sponsor, including support for a competition with prizes that include the chance for one school to win a training day with former England and Saracens star Richard Hill.

Tim Button, Event Director, welcomed the new sponsorship: “Lexus has long been an advocate of such social enhancement through sporting opportunities and we are excited to be commencing the first rounds of the tournament with its generous support.

“Over 17 years the event has provided tens of thousands of children with the opportunity to play rugby in a friendly, competitive, exciting, yet safe environment. Many have since carved careers in the professional game, but equally many go on to play to other levels, continuing to enjoy the genuine camaraderie the game engenders.”

Richard Balshaw, Lexus Director, said: “The Lexus National Schools Rugby Tournament represents all that is best about the sport and is an excellent way of encouraging and developing the skills of young people. It gives us an excellent opportunity to support the endeavours of these young players and also a great arena in which we can promote our businesses and our vehicles.”


Lexus honoured as Auto Express Manufacturer of the Decade

Awards come and awards go, but the latest addition to Lexus’s packed trophy cabinet represents a more enduring success for the luxury brand: it has been named Auto Express Manufacturer of the Decade. The award recognises the fact that Lexus has achieved the highest average satisfaction rating of any car maker over the past 10 years – 88.3 per cent – based on more than 300,000 responses from motorists to Auto Express’s annual Driver Power survey.

 

During the past 10 years, Lexus has won the magazine’s Manufacturer of the Year award seven times, and its centre network has been named the nation’s best every single year. This unprecedented achievement reflects the high approval of Lexus customers for the quality of their vehicles – both new and used – and the service they receive.

This period has seen Lexus take a lead in the premium market with hybrid power and it is a mark of its success in bringing the technology to the mainstream that the second-generation RX crossover – the vehicle with which it launched its hybrid programme – takes third place among Auto Express’s Cars of the Decade.

Graham Hope, Auto Express Deputy Editor, said: “This award, based on the responses of more than 300,000 Auto Express readers over 10 years, shows how much Lexus owners love their cars.

“Their supreme comfort and great build quality are regularly praised, and this is backed up by aftersales service which is unmatched in the industry. Lexus is a thoroughly deserving winner of our Manufacturer of the Decade award, and will no doubt continue its success in the years ahead.”

Jon Williams, Toyota GB Managing Director, said: “It is a great honour to receive this award, particularly as Lexus was only introduced into the UK market in 1990.

Positioning the Lexus brand as number one for customer service was our aim and maintaining this for a decade proves the commitment of each and every individual in the Lexus network.”
